CTrees scientists will present at AGU25 in New Orleans from December 15-19, 2025.

Featuring thousands of scientists, educators, and policymakers from around the world, AGU is the largest annual gathering of Earth and space scientists.

Members of the CTrees science team participating in the conference this year will include:
